Abstract

A hydrocarbon fuel such as a gasoline exhibiting substantially improved laminar burning velocity and method of making. The hydrocarbon fuel may comprise a paraffinic fraction, an olefinic fraction, and an aromatics fraction. The aromatics fraction may comprise methyl aromatics and non-methyl alkyl aromatics wherein the percentage of non-methyl alkyl aromatics in the aromatics fraction is at least 30% by volume. The fuel may comprise a methyl aromatics fraction comprising xylenes wherein the percentage of ortho- and para-xylene in the xylene fraction is at least 60% by volume.

Claims

exact text as granted — not AI-modified
1 . An unleaded hydrocarbon fuel comprising a paraffinic fraction, an olefinic fraction, and an aromatics fraction, wherein said aromatics fraction comprises methyl aromatics and non-methyl alkyl aromatics and the percentage of non-methyl alkyl aromatics in said aromatics fraction is at least 30% by volume.  
     
     
         2 . The hydrocarbon fuel of  claim 1 , wherein said paraffinic fraction is in an amount of 90% or less by volume, said olefinic fraction is in an amount of 30% or less by volume, and said aromatics fraction is in an amount of 70% or less by volume.  
     
     
         3 . The hydrocarbon fuel of  claim 1 , wherein the percentage of non-methyl alkyl aromatics in said aromatics fraction is at least 50% by volume.  
     
     
         4 . The hydrocarbon fuel of  claim 1 , wherein the percentage of non-methyl alkyl aromatics in said aromatics fraction is at least 70% by volume.  
     
     
         5 . The hydrocarbon fuel of  claim 1 , wherein said methyl aromatics fraction comprises xylenes and the percentage of ortho- and para-xylene in said xylene fraction is at least 60% by volume.  
     
     
         6 . The hydrocarbon fuel of  claim 1 , wherein said methyl aromatics fraction comprises xylenes and the percentage of ortho- and para-xylene in said xylene fraction is at least 75% by volume.  
     
     
         7 . The hydrocarbon fuel of  claim 1 , wherein said methyl aromatics fraction comprises xylenes and the percentage of ortho- and para-xylene in said xylene fraction is at least 90% by volume.  
     
     
         8 . The hydrocarbon fuel of  claim 1 , further comprising benzene in an amount of 1% or less by volume, and sulfur in an amount of 30 ppm or less by weight.  
     
     
         9 . An unleaded hydrocarbon fuel comprising a paraffinic fraction, an olefinic fraction, and an aromatics fraction, wherein said aromatics fraction comprises a xylene fraction and wherein the percentage of ortho- and para-xylene in said xylene fraction is at least 60% by volume.  
     
     
         10 . The hydrocarbon fuel of  claim 9 , wherein the percentage of ortho- and para-xylene in said xylene fraction is at least 75% by volume.  
     
     
         11 . The hydrocarbon fuel of  claim 9 , wherein the percentage of ortho- and para-xylene in said xylene fraction is at least 90% by volume.  
     
     
         12 . The hydrocarbon fuel of  claim 9 , further comprising benzene in an amount 1% or less by volume, and sulfur in an amount of 30 ppm or less by weight.  
     
     
         13 . A method for making a hydrocarbon fuel having an improved laminar burning velocity the method comprising: 
 providing a hydrocarbon fuel comprising a paraffinic fraction, an olefinic fraction, and an aromatic fraction wherein said aromatic fraction comprises methyl aromatics and non-methyl alkyl aromatics; and    controlling the percentage of said non-methyl alkyl aromatics in said aromatics fraction to at least 30% by volume.    
     
     
         14 . The method of  claim 13 , further comprising controlling the percentage said of non-methyl alkyl aromatics in said aromatics fraction to at least 50% by volume.  
     
     
         15 . The method of  claim 13 , further comprising controlling said percentage of said non-methyl alkyl aromatics in said aromatics fraction to at least 70% by volume.  
     
     
         16 . A method for making a hydrocarbon fuel having an improved laminar burning velocity the method comprising providing a hydrocarbon fuel comprising a paraffinic fraction, an olefinic fraction, and an aromatic fraction comprising methyl aromatics and non-methyl alkyl aromatics, wherein said methyl aromatics fraction comprises xylenes; and 
 controlling the percentage of ortho- and para-xylene in the xylene fraction to at least 60% by volume.    
     
     
         17 . The method of  claim 16 , further comprising controlling the percentage of ortho- and para-xylene in the xylene fraction to at least 75% by volume.  
     
     
         18 . The method of  claim 16 , further comprising controlling the percentage of ortho- and para-xylene in the xylene fraction to at least 90% by volume.
